Former Australia opener Usman Khawaja was in disbelief when he heard that the Pakistan Cricket Board (PCB) penalised their T20 World Cup 2026 players for not performing according to expectations. Khawaja came to social media to express his disbelief and dissatisfaction over the Pakistan Cricket Board. The former cricketer said that Pakistan has turned into a drama series for him.

Pakistan National Cricket Team got eliminated from the Super 8 of the ongoing T20 World Cup, even after winning their last Super 8 match against Sri Lanka. Because of a low run rate, the Salman Ali Agha-led team was ruled out of the title contention.

Usman Khawaja openly mocks the Pakistan Cricket Board for penalising the cricketers

Winning and losing are all part of every game. But sanctioning penalties only because of underperforming, is a rare occasion in cricket. Cricket experts and fans, were in shock as soon as the news came out in public domains. Usman Khawaja is the latest to speak out on the matter.

Mocking PCB, the former Australian cricketer, who was born in Islamabad, Pakistan, described that sanction penalties over the cricketers are a horrible decision by the board as the players are already under pressure, an no-one walks into the ground to be defeated.

Mohsin Naqvi-led Pakistan Cricket Board is in front of some serious questions raised by the former cricketer

"Amazingly, the PCB could think that this is a good idea. Sorry, I'm laughing because I can't believe it. In what high-performance team in the entire world, let alone cricket, are players getting fined when they lose cricket games?", Khawaja raised the question to the Mohsin Naqvi-led Pakistan Cricket Board.

"They're not trying to lose cricket games. And how do you even think that makes them perform better next time? All it does is put more pressure and more stress on the players. I mean, they're under enough pressure. They're Pakistani players", Usman Khawaja further said in his reaction video.

Usman Khawaja compares Pakistan to a drama series

Khawaja directly said that it is a shame that PCB issued fines against the players who went into the event to represent the nation. He stated that to him, Pakistan is nothing but a drama, and he is waiting for the next episode.

"The whole country is watching them. I mean, even the selection in the past had put them under pressure as players. And now, on top of that, you're fining them? It's an absolute shame because I really feel for the Pakistani players. Poor Pakistani players... Every time I think Pakistan's not going to surprise me, they surprise me. It's like a drama series. I can't wait for the next episode", the 39-year-old concluded.

According to media reports, all of the members of Pakistan's T20 World Cup 2026 squad, have been fined PKR 5 million (US$ 18,000 approx.) each by the PCB following their underwhelming campaign.
